| ## Key Improvements | |
| ### Content-Type Checking Pattern | |
| ```javascript | |
| if (response.ok) { | |
| const contentType = response.headers.get('content-type'); | |
| if (contentType && contentType.includes('application/json')) { | |
| const data = await response.json(); | |
| // Process data | |
| } | |
| } | |
| ``` | |
| ### Graceful Degradation | |
| 1. Try primary API endpoint | |
| 2. Try fallback API (if available) | |
| 3. Use demo/empty data | |
| 4. Show user-friendly error message | |
| ### Null-Safe DOM Updates | |
| ```javascript | |
| const element = document.getElementById('some-id'); | |
| if (element) { | |
| element.textContent = value; | |
| } | |
| ``` | |
